JANAKPURDHAM: Madhesh Province Chief Minister Satish Kumar Singh has dismissed eight State Ministers.

This decision comes in response to widespread criticism regarding the formation of a jumbo cabinet.

Chief Minister Singh stated that the dismissals were made based on recommendations from the parties involved in the government.

Chief Minister Singh had earlier appointed Rekha Thakur, Neelam Kumari Rajak, Rambabu Yadav, Shambhu Sah, and Mohammad Zayed Alam as Ministers of State.

Previously, Keshav Rai, Sharada Devi Thapa, and Ranju Kumari Mandal Khang had also been appointed as Ministers of State.

Following these changes, the Madhesh province cabinet will now consist of 12 ministers, including the Chief Minister.
